Venue
The NRMA Victor Harbor Beachfront Holiday Park was awarded the 2017 Silver Medal in the South Australian Tourism Industry Awards and is set on absolute beachfront facing the Great Australian Bight, and is bounded on another side by the Inman River. The Park is within easy walking distance of the centre of Victor Harbor, Granite Island and the historical precinct. Victor Harbor is located on the Fleurieu Peninsula, 85 km south of Adelaide. There are lots of interesting things to do around the town and the surrounding region. Victor Harbor is a short distance away by car from Goolwa, the Coorong and mouth of the Murray. The McClaren Vale wine district is also only a few kilometres away. More information about Victor Harbor can be found here.

Who can attend?
The Nationals are mainly intended as an Australia-wide get together for forum members and others with Vintage Caravans. Don't have a vintage caravan? Keep reading, because we are aware that some forum members have classic or vintage reproduction caravans, and that other V V’ers like to attend events with friends who come in modern (ie 1980+) vans. Other people come because they have an interest in vintage or older caravans, or want to be inspired by seeing 100+ vintage caravans together all in one place. All such people are very welcome to attend WITH their caravans. The Nationals are partly about creating a spectacle of vintage vanning, but we don't wish to exclude anyone who would like to attend.
An option for anyone wanting to attend - but who can’t bring their vintage or other caravan - is to book a cabin or villa.
We encourage everyone to come to the Nationals for the full week so that we can have the opportunity to meet each other, admire each others' caravans, and participate in the program of activities. However, you are still very welcome to attend even if you can only come for a few days due to work or other commitments.
